I’m part of a very cool project on Thursday and Friday of this week at Cat’s Cradle in Carrboro, NC. It’s a fully orchestrated live performance of Big Star’s third album – Sister Lovers. Big Star was the band formed by Alex Chilton that so many musicians site as a major influence. Local record producer, Chris Stamey, a long time Big Star associate, has spearheaded the project including building many of the arrangements. Chris has also assembled an impressive list of performers including Joey Stevens, an original member of Big Star, Mike Mills of REM, and members of The Love Language, Lost in the Trees, Megafaun, and the North Carolina Symphony.
Proceeds will benefit Kidznotes of Durham, and the New Orleans Musicians’ Clinic.
